Descripciòn

SRXN1 Protein, Human (His, Myc) is the recombinant human-derived SRXN1 protein, expressed by E. coli, with N-10*His & C-Myc tag.

Background

SRXN1 contributes to oxidative stress resistance by reducing cysteine-sulfinic acid formed in peroxiredoxins PRDX1, PRDX2, PRDX3, and PRDX4 under oxidant exposure. It does not act on PRDX5 or PRDX6. The protein may catalyze the reduction in a multi-step process by functioning as both a specific phosphotransferase and a thioltransferase. by similar: This function is associated with SRXN1's protective role in oxidative stress.

  • Do most proteins show cross-species activity?

    Species cross-reactivity must be investigated individually for each product. Many human cytokines will produce a nice response in mouse cell lines, and many mouse proteins will show activity on human cells. Other proteins may have a lower specific activity when used in the opposite species.
